Supraventricular tachycardia is the most common symptomatic arrhythmia in children. Therefore, paediatricians should be familiar with this problem. There has been great progress recently. Pathophysiological mechanisms are better known and pharmacological options more diversified. Also, curative therapy is available by catheter ablation. This article reviews this cardiac rate disorder under a number of perspectives: definition, epidemiology, categories (mainly Wolff-Parkinson-White syndrome and atrioventricular node reentry), clinical features, differential diagnosis, therapeutic options and prognosis.
